Skills
- Ability to read and comprehend written instruction.
- Effectively write electronic service reports.
- Effectively present information in one-on-one and small group situations to internal and external customers and other employees of the organization.
- Ability to fulfill the essential functions in a consistent state of alertness and safe manner.
- 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als.
- Ability to compute KW, KVA, rate, ratio and percentage.
-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ions furnished in written, oral or diagram form.
- Ability to deal with problems involving several concrete variables in standardized situations.
- Ability to read electrical schematics and one-line diagrams.
- Ability to apply Ohm’s law and understand basic electrical formulas.
- Rudimentary knowledge of motor controls, circuits, and distribution.
- Ability to discuss and implement generator paralleling schemes.
